The good news is that medical experts have found excessive sweating to be not a serious threat to life. Medical conditions like heart and lung disease, anxiety disorder, diabetes mellitus and certain medications are triggers of secondary hyperhidrosis. It is important that you understand the causes of your excessive sweating to know how to stop excessive sweating. Medically known as hyperhidrosis, excessive sweating can happen due to natural reasons or because of some other underlying condition. In either case, excessive sweating is not only cause social embarrassment due to the strong odour, but can cause further anxiety and stress.

Medications may work for slight cases of hyperhidrosis but may not be as effective for others, making the success rate very limited. Aside from this, medications for hyperhidrosis also have several bothersome side effects such as dry mouth and dizziness. Rest assured however, that excessive sweating is non-life-threatening and can also be treated through natural means.
